HOW TO FOLD AND MOVE THE TREADMILL
HOW TO FOLD THE TREADMmLL FOR STORAGE
Before folding the treadmill, adjust the incline to the
towest position, ff this is not done, the treadmill may be per-
manently damaged. Remove the key and unptug the power
cord. CAUTmON: You must be able to safely tift 45 pounds
(20 kg) to raise, lower, or move the treadmill.
1, HoUdthe treadmHUwith your hands in the Uocationshown by
the arrow at the right, CAUTION: To decrease the possi-
biJity of injury, bend your tegs and keep your back
straight. As you raise the treadmill, make sure to lift
with your tegs rather than your back. Raise the treadmill
about halfway to the vertical position,
2, Move your right hand to the position shown and hold the
treadmill firmly, Using your left hand, pull the latch knob to
the left and hold it, Raise the treadmill until the latch pin is
aligned with the indicated hole in the catch, Insert the
latch pin into the hole, Make sure that the tatch pin is
fully inserted into the hote.
To protect the floor or carpet from damage, ptace a
mat under the treadmill. Keep the treadmill out of
direct sunlight. Do not tears the treadmill in the stor-
age position in temperatures above 85° Fahrenheit.
HOW TO MOVE THE TREADMILL
Before moving the treadmill, convert the treadmill to the stor-
age position as described above, Make sure that the latch
pin is fully inserted into the hote in the side of the tread-
mitt.
1. Hold the handrails as shown and place one foot against a
wheel.
2. Tilt the treadmill back until it rolls freely on the wheels.
Carefully move the treadmill to the desired location. Never
move the treadmill without tipping it back. To reduce
the risk of injury, use extreme caution whiJe moving
the treadmill. Do not attempt to move the treadmill
over an uneven surface.
3, Place one foot on wheel, and carefully lower the treadmill
until it is resting in the storage position,
